Thanamir Apple Festival: People asked to produce more

Dimapur, Sep. 13 (EMN): Thanamir Village Council organised the 8th Thanamir Apple festival in collaboration with the department of Horticulture at the public ground of the village on September 13. Advisor for Horticulture and Border Affairs, Mhathung Yanthan was the special guest of the programme.

Addressing the gathering, Yanthan said Thanamir was created by God in a special way with wonderful people and blessed with rich natural resources, informed an update from DIPR. He advised the people of the village and nearby villages to increase apple production through proper management.

Yanthan encouraged the villagers “to get involved in promoting agriculture which can be good for economic growth as well as for health benefits.” He also assured the people that his department would assist in getting right apple species for the cultivators in order to produce more.

Toshi Wangtung, advisor IPR, SCERT & village guard, stressed on conserving forests, stating that it “must be conserved in a larger way because cutting down of trees will lead to climatic change which will have negative impact on the cultivation of apples as well as for human survival in different ways.”

President of Yimchungru Tribal Council (YTC), Throngso encouraged the people to produce more apples, pointing out that the fruit grows well only in a few places.
